Let's start of with one of the most classic French dishes: escargot. It was my first time eating snails and I was surprised to find them quite tasty...probably because of the butter and garlic they're soaked in. This was an appetizer by the way...my friend and I shared it for dinner and we were very full (aka much bread was eaten to mop up the buttery sauce).
French people are also surprisingly good at making pizza (maybe because they're so close to Italy). An egg on a pizza is a pretty customary thing, and quite ingenious. I think the only eggs I ate in France were on top of pizzas.
